book: American Gods

"American Gods" by Neil Gaiman is in my top 5. I would have to say that it is most at home in the fantasy catagory but don't let that put you off. It was a book centered on an ex-convict named Shadow who finds himself widowed and adrift until he is employed by a strange man known as Friday.
The book is about the various gods and goddesses from different countries and how they were brought to America by immigrants and what happened to them as the people became American and started to lose their old ways and objects of worship. It is fascinating and once you pick it up you can't put it down. The narration and description of settings are so spot on that you can almost feel the place being described in the narrations.
